Ingredients and Preparation

Essential Ingredients and Possible Substitutions

To craft these delicious peppermint patties, you’ll need the following essential ingredients:

  • Powdered Sugar: This serves as the base for your mint filling, lending the necessary sweetness.
  • Sweetened Condensed Milk: It keeps the filling moist and creamy, bringing everything together beautifully.
  • Peppermint Extract: This is where the refreshing flavor comes from! Adjusting the quantity will let you personalize the intensity of the mint.
  • Chocolate (Semi-Sweet or Dark): For the outer layer, go for high-quality chocolate to ensure a decadent finish.

If you’re looking into substitutions, here are a few ideas:

  • Swap powdered sugar with monk fruit sweetener for a low-carb version.
  • Use coconut cream instead of sweetened condensed milk for a dairy-free option.
  • If peppermint extract isn’t on hand, spearmint extract can be a milder alternative.

Step-by-Step Recipe Instructions with Tips

  1. Prepare the Mint Filling: In a bowl, mix together 3 cups of powdered sugar, 2 tablespoons of sweetened condensed milk, and 1 teaspoon of peppermint extract. Stir until you have a thick paste. If it’s too sticky, add a bit more sugar. If it’s too dry, a splash of milk can help.

  2. Shape the Patties: Use your hands to roll the mixture into small balls, then flatten them into discs about a quarter-inch thick. Place them on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per and freeze them for about 30 minutes or until firm.

  3. Melt the Chocolate: In a double boiler, gently melt 8 ounces of your chosen chocolate until it’s silky smooth. Stir frequently to avoid burning.

  4. Coat the Patties: Remove the mint discs from the freezer and dip each one into the melted chocolate. Use a fork to help lift them out, tapping off any excess chocolate before placing them back on the parchment paper.

  5. Set and Enjoy: Let the coated patties sit at room temperature or in the refrigerator until the chocolate hardens. Enjoy with family and friends!

Cooking Techniques and Tips

How to Cook Peppermint Patties Homemade Recipe Perfectly

To make sure your peppermint patties turn out just right, pay attention to the quality of the chocolate you use. A high cocoa content enhances the richness of the patties. Additionally, set your workspace up efficiently; having everything ready beforehand makes the process smoother—and who doesn’t love a little organization in the kitchen?

Another tip is to be patient while the chocolate sets. Resist the urge to rush this step; allowing them to firm up will ensure a delightful snap when bitten into.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

One common mistake is overmixing the mint filling. You want it to be just combined to retain that creamy texture. Also, be cautious with the mint extract; it’s potent, and a little goes a long way. Starting with less and tasting is always best!

Another pitfall is not letting them chill sufficiently before dipping. If the discs are too soft, they can lose their shape in the warm chocolate. Be patient—good things come to those who wait!

How do I store leftover Peppermint Patties Homemade Recipe?
Store any leftover peppermint patties in an airtight container at room temperature or in the refrigerator for up to two weeks. Just ensure they’re well-separated; you don’t want to lose their delightful chocolate coating!

Can I freeze Peppermint Patties Homemade Recipe?
Absolutely! These lovely treats freeze wonderfully. Just layer parchment paper between the rows in an airtight container, and they can last for up to three months in the freezer.

Ingredients

Scale
  • 3 cups powdered sugar
  • 2 tablespoons sweetened condensed milk
  • 1 teaspoon peppermint extract
  • 8 ounces semi-sweet or dark chocolate

Instructions

  1. Prepare the Mint Filling: In a bowl, mix together powdered sugar, sweetened condensed milk, and peppermint extract until you have a thick paste.
  2. Shape the Patties: Roll the mixture into small balls and flatten them into discs, then freeze on a parchment-lined baking sheet.
  3. Melt the Chocolate: In a double boiler, gently melt your chosen chocolate until silky smooth.
  4. Coat the Patties: Dip each mint disc into the melted chocolate, tapping off excess before placing them back on parchment paper.
  5. Set and Enjoy: Let the coated patties sit until the chocolate hardens, then enjoy with family and friends!
